The transfer saga involving Tottenham star Cristian Romero never seems to end. The Argentina international has quickly become a prominent figure at N17 following his switch from Atalanta in 2021. And it is fair to suggest that the 27-year-old is a fan-favourite at the club due to his sheer consistency week in week out and his winning mentality.
It is not a surprise that Romero’s best performance for Spurs came during the club’s most important game in the last two decades. The centre-back was head and shoulders clear of everyone else in the Europa League final, and proved why he is considered to be the ‘best centre-back in the world.’ The 27-year-old did not let anyone go through him, helping the Lilywhites earn a rare clean sheet.
Fans are hoping to see Cristian Romero don the Lilywhite jersey again next season as Tottenham look to kickstart a new era at N17 under Thomas Frank. The club cannot afford to lose a player like him, and his influence in the dressing room speaks volumes. The Lilywhites are looking to build on the Europa League success next season, and having the Argentinian around will only bolster the team’s chances of enduring a solid domestic campaign next season.
It has become common knowledge now that Atletico Madrid are trying all tricks in the book to land Cristian Romero in the summer. It was reported earlier that Diego Simeone is ‘desperate’ to land the prolific centre-back for next season, and the Atleti manager is calling Romero ‘every day’ to try and lure him to join the La Liga giants in the summer.
Now, Steven Caulker has urged Spurs to do everything they can to retain the centre-back in the summer. Speaking on talkSPORT, Caulker said,
“No, he is a player that Spurs need absolutely. He is someone who is sort of the backbone of Spurs if you like. You know he is often given the armband. If you are talking about defining the season, I think keeping hold of the leaders within the team or the more experienced players is going to be vital.”

The ex-Spurs player added,
“It is going to be really, really important. So, the fact that they are playing Champions League football this season, I would like to see the bigger names stay. Cristian Romero is certainly one of them.”
Steven Caulker believes Tottenham need to keep hold of Cristian Romero in the summer as he is the backbone of the team. The ex-player believes that the centre-back is a natural leader and the club must retain him for next season. Caulker points out that the Lilywhites are going to play Champions League football next season and they will need bigger personalities in the team, and the Argentinian is one of them.
It is fair to say that Tottenham are thinking on the same lines as the club aims to pull out all stops to keep hold of the ex-Atalanta star. It was reported earlier that Thomas Frank aims to make Cristian Romero a crucial part of the team, and Daniel Levy is ready to make the Argentinian the highest paid player at N17 in an attempt to make him stay at Hotspur Way.
